Holidays can be stressful times in many families for various reasons, but this year Covid-19 has imposed an unprecedented challenge on all of us. Should we get together with our extended families and possibly put vulnerable family members at risk or do we stay at home and celebrate as best we can under the circumstances?  As the University of Chicago recommends, “you’ll need to get creative and have honest (and possibly uncomfortable) conversations with every member of your family about their individual safety needs and risk tolerances.”  The CDC, the Illinois Department of Public Health, Cleveland Clinic, and the University of Chicago Medicine have released these guidelines and suggestions for how to handle this dilemma. Talk to your family doctor for guidance as well.
